The Old Republic was the legendary government that united a galaxy under the rule of the Senate. In This era, the Jedi are numerous, and serve as guardians of peace and justice. The Old Republic comic series takes place in this era, chronicling the immense wars fought by the Jedi of old, and the ancient Sith.
The Galactic Republic had led civilization into a golden age – its trillions of citizens governed by a democratic senate and protected by the mystical Jedi Order. Then the Sith Empire returned. Born of Jedi Knights who had fallen into Darkness, this ancient enemy of the Republic had become a powerful and terrifying nation beyond the edges of known space. The Empire struck blow after blow against the free peoples of the galaxy, conquering territory and exacting revenge against the Jedi. It was nearly three decades before the war ended and even then, neither side could claim total victory…
Stories/Spoilers
In part #1, Theron Shan – descendant of the legendary bloodline that includes Jedi Bastila Shan and Satele Shan – is no Jedi he’s a Republic spy! His mission: to discover the blackest secret at the heart of the evil Sith Empire!
Next in part #2, There are dark secrets behind the treaty that brought peace to the galaxy and an end to the war between the Jedi of the Republic and the Sith Empire. Now, with rumors of the secrets spreading, the galaxy is afraid a new war may be beginning… Elite Republic spy Theron Shan has been assigned to find the old Jedi Master behind these rumors. Previously thought lost forever in Sith territory, Ngani Zho is back and more peculiar than before he left. Theron has his hands full with Zho, a troublesome thief, and the threatening Sith Knights who are also on Zho’s trail!
Next in part #3, The war that ended in a tense peace agreement is in danger of beginning again, but elite Republic spy Theron Shan is going to do everything in his power to prevent it — including infiltrating the Imperial space of Darth Mekhis to find out what is happening! Along with Master Zho, and the criminal in his custody, Teff’ith, Theron is headed to Port Nowhere. He hasn’t got a plan or any idea what he may be going to face, but for a spy, he’s got great style!
Next in part #4, Captured by the evil Sith Empire, Republic spy Theron Shan is about to find out what secret sacrifice brought about the end of the great war. But once the Imperial’s covert activities are revealed, will he be able to act on his devastating discoveries?
Finally in part #5, Republic spy Theron Shan puts all he has into surviving — and stopping — the Sith’s star-killing Sun Razer. This megaweapon must be destroyed and the Republic must be warned of the threat!
Trade Paperback reprints/collects: Star Wars: The Old Republic – The Lost Suns (2011) Issues #1-5. Dark Horse Comics
